void
g_part_geometry_heads(off_t blocks, u_int sectors, off_t *bestchs,
    u_int *bestheads)
{
        static u_int candidate_heads[] = { 1, 2, 16, 32, 64, 128, 255, 0 };
        off_t chs, cylinders;
        u_int heads;
        int idx;

        *bestchs = 0;
        *bestheads = 0;
        for (idx = 0; candidate_heads[idx] != 0; idx++) {
                heads = candidate_heads[idx];
                cylinders = blocks / heads / sectors;
                if (cylinders < heads || cylinders < sectors)
                        break;
                if (cylinders > 1023)
                        continue;
                chs = cylinders * heads * sectors;
                if (chs > *bestchs || (chs == *bestchs && *bestheads == 1)) {
                        *bestchs = chs;
                        *bestheads = heads;
                }
        }
}

static void
g_part_geometry(struct g_part_table *table, struct g_consumer *cp,
    off_t blocks)
{
        static u_int candidate_sectors[] = { 1, 9, 17, 33, 63, 0 };
        off_t chs, bestchs;
        u_int heads, sectors;
        int idx;

        if (g_getattr("GEOM::fwsectors", cp, &sectors) != 0 || sectors == 0 ||
            g_getattr("GEOM::fwheads", cp, &heads) != 0 || heads == 0) {
                table->gpt_fixgeom = 0;
                table->gpt_heads = 0;
                table->gpt_sectors = 0;
                bestchs = 0;
                for (idx = 0; candidate_sectors[idx] != 0; idx++) {
                        sectors = candidate_sectors[idx];
                        g_part_geometry_heads(blocks, sectors, &chs, &heads);
                        if (chs == 0)
                                continue;
                        /*
                         * Prefer a geometry with sectors > 1, but only if
                         * it doesn't bump down the number of heads to 1.
                         */
                        if (chs > bestchs || (chs == bestchs && heads > 1 &&
                            table->gpt_sectors == 1)) {
                                bestchs = chs;
                                table->gpt_heads = heads;
                                table->gpt_sectors = sectors;
                        }
                }
                /*
                 * If we didn't find a geometry at all, then the disk is
                 * too big. This means we can use the maximum number of
                 * heads and sectors.
                 */
                if (bestchs == 0) {
                        table->gpt_heads = 255;
                        table->gpt_sectors = 63;
                }
        } else {
                table->gpt_fixgeom = 1;
                table->gpt_heads = heads;
                table->gpt_sectors = sectors;
        }
}

static int
g_part_check_integrity(struct g_part_table *table, struct g_consumer *cp)
{
        struct g_part_entry *e1, *e2;
        struct g_provider *pp;
        off_t offset;
        int failed;

        failed = 0;
        pp = cp->provider;
        if (table->gpt_last < table->gpt_first) {
                DPRINTF("last LBA is below first LBA: %jd < %jd\n",
                    (intmax_t)table->gpt_last, (intmax_t)table->gpt_first);
                failed++;
        }
        if (table->gpt_last > pp->mediasize / pp->sectorsize - 1) {
                DPRINTF("last LBA extends beyond mediasize: "
                    "%jd > %jd\n", (intmax_t)table->gpt_last,
                    (intmax_t)pp->mediasize / pp->sectorsize - 1);
                failed++;
        }
        LIST_FOREACH(e1, &table->gpt_entry, gpe_entry) {
                if (e1->gpe_deleted || e1->gpe_internal)
                        continue;
                if (e1->gpe_start < table->gpt_first) {
                        DPRINTF("partition %d has start offset below first "
                            "LBA: %jd < %jd\n", e1->gpe_index,
                            (intmax_t)e1->gpe_start,
                            (intmax_t)table->gpt_first);
                        failed++;
                }
                if (e1->gpe_start > table->gpt_last) {
                        DPRINTF("partition %d has start offset beyond last "
                            "LBA: %jd > %jd\n", e1->gpe_index,
                            (intmax_t)e1->gpe_start,
                            (intmax_t)table->gpt_last);
                        failed++;
                }
                if (e1->gpe_end < e1->gpe_start) {
                        DPRINTF("partition %d has end offset below start "
                            "offset: %jd < %jd\n", e1->gpe_index,
                            (intmax_t)e1->gpe_end,
                            (intmax_t)e1->gpe_start);
                        failed++;
                }
                if (e1->gpe_end > table->gpt_last) {
                        DPRINTF("partition %d has end offset beyond last "
                            "LBA: %jd > %jd\n", e1->gpe_index,
                            (intmax_t)e1->gpe_end,
                            (intmax_t)table->gpt_last);
                        failed++;
                }
                if (pp->stripesize > 0) {
                        offset = e1->gpe_start * pp->sectorsize;
                        if (e1->gpe_offset > offset)
                                offset = e1->gpe_offset;
                        if ((offset + pp->stripeoffset) % pp->stripesize) {
                                DPRINTF("partition %d on (%s, %s) is not "
                                    "aligned on %ju bytes\n", e1->gpe_index,
                                    pp->name, table->gpt_scheme->name,
                                    (uintmax_t)pp->stripesize);
                                /* Don't treat this as a critical failure */
                        }
                }
                e2 = e1;
                while ((e2 = LIST_NEXT(e2, gpe_entry)) != NULL) {
                        if (e2->gpe_deleted || e2->gpe_internal)
                                continue;
                        if (e1->gpe_start >= e2->gpe_start &&
                            e1->gpe_start <= e2->gpe_end) {
                                DPRINTF("partition %d has start offset inside "
                                    "partition %d: start[%d] %jd >= start[%d] "
                                    "%jd <= end[%d] %jd\n",
                                    e1->gpe_index, e2->gpe_index,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_start,
                                    e1->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e1->gpe_start,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_end);
                                failed++;
                        }
                        if (e1->gpe_end >= e2->gpe_start &&
                            e1->gpe_end <= e2->gpe_end) {
                                DPRINTF("partition %d has end offset inside "
                                    "partition %d: start[%d] %jd >= end[%d] "
                                    "%jd <= end[%d] %jd\n",
                                    e1->gpe_index, e2->gpe_index,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_start,
                                    e1->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e1->gpe_end,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_end);
                                failed++;
                        }
                        if (e1->gpe_start < e2->gpe_start &&
                            e1->gpe_end > e2->gpe_end) {
                                DPRINTF("partition %d contains partition %d: "
                                    "start[%d] %jd > start[%d] %jd, end[%d] "
                                    "%jd < end[%d] %jd\n",
                                    e1->gpe_index, e2->gpe_index,
                                    e1->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e1->gpe_start,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_start,
                                    e2->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e2->gpe_end,
                                    e1->gpe_index, (intmax_t)e1->gpe_end);
                                failed++;
                        }
                }
        }
        if (failed != 0) {
                printf("GEOM_PART: integrity check failed (%s, %s)\n",
                    pp->name, table->gpt_scheme->name);
                if (geom_part_check_integrity != 0)
                        return (EINVAL);
                table->gpt_corrupt = 1;
        }
        return (0);
}
#undef  DPRINTF

static struct g_geom *
g_part_taste(struct g_class *mp, struct g_provider *pp, int flags __unused)
{
        struct g_consumer *cp;
        struct g_geom *gp;
        struct g_part_entry *entry;
        struct g_part_table *table;
        struct root_hold_token *rht;
        int attr, depth;
        int error;

        G_PART_TRACE((G_T_TOPOLOGY, "%s(%s,%s)", __func__, mp->name, pp->name));
        g_topology_assert();

        /* Skip providers that are already open for writing. */
        if (pp->acw > 0)
                return (NULL);

        /*
         * Create a GEOM with consumer and hook it up to the provider.
         * With that we become part of the topology. Obtain read access
         * to the provider.
         */
        gp = g_new_geom(mp, pp->name);
        cp = g_new_consumer(gp);
        cp->flags |= G_CF_DIRECT_SEND | G_CF_DIRECT_RECEIVE;
        error = g_attach(cp, pp);
        if (error == 0)
                error = g_access(cp, 1, 0, 0);
        if (error != 0) {
                if (cp->provider)
                        g_detach(cp);
                g_destroy_consumer(cp);
                g_destroy_geom(gp);
                return (NULL);
        }

        rht = root_mount_hold(mp->name);
        g_topology_unlock();

        /*
         * Short-circuit the whole probing galore when there's no
         * media present.
         */
        if (pp->mediasize == 0 || pp->sectorsize == 0) {
                error = ENODEV;
                goto fail;
        }

        /* Make sure we can nest and if so, determine our depth. */
        error = g_getattr("PART::isleaf", cp, &attr);
        if (!error && attr) {
                error = ENODEV;
                goto fail;
        }
        error = g_getattr("PART::depth", cp, &attr);
        depth = (!error) ? attr + 1 : 0;

        error = g_part_probe(gp, cp, depth);
        if (error)
                goto fail;

        table = gp->softc;

        /*
         * Synthesize a disk geometry. Some partitioning schemes
         * depend on it and since some file systems need it even
         * when the partition scheme doesn't, we do it here in
         * scheme-independent code.
         */
        g_part_geometry(table, cp, pp->mediasize / pp->sectorsize);

        error = G_PART_READ(table, cp);
        if (error)
                goto fail;
        error = g_part_check_integrity(table, cp);
        if (error)
                goto fail;

        g_topology_lock();
        LIST_FOREACH(entry, &table->gpt_entry, gpe_entry) {
                if (!entry->gpe_internal)
                        g_part_new_provider(gp, table, entry);
        }

        root_mount_rel(rht);
        g_access(cp, -1, 0, 0);
        return (gp);

 fail:
        g_topology_lock();
        root_mount_rel(rht);
        g_access(cp, -1, 0, 0);
        g_detach(cp);
        g_destroy_consumer(cp);
        g_destroy_geom(gp);
        return (NULL);
}

static void
g_part_start(struct bio *bp)
{
        struct bio *bp2;
        struct g_consumer *cp;
        struct g_geom *gp;
        struct g_part_entry *entry;
        struct g_part_table *table;
        struct g_kerneldump *gkd;
        struct g_provider *pp;
        void (*done_func)(struct bio *) = g_std_done;
        char buf[64];

        biotrack(bp, __func__);

        pp = bp->bio_to;
        gp = pp->geom;
        table = gp->softc;
        cp = LIST_FIRST(&gp->consumer);

        G_PART_TRACE((G_T_BIO, "%s: cmd=%d, provider=%s", __func__, bp->bio_cmd,
            pp->name));

        entry = pp->private;
        if (entry == NULL) {
                g_io_deliver(bp, ENXIO);
                return;
        }

        switch(bp->bio_cmd) {
        case BIO_DELETE:
        case BIO_READ:
        case BIO_WRITE:
                if (bp->bio_offset >= pp->mediasize) {
                        g_io_deliver(bp, EIO);
                        return;
                }
                bp2 = g_clone_bio(bp);
                if (bp2 == NULL) {
                        g_io_deliver(bp, ENOMEM);
                        return;
                }
                if (bp2->bio_offset + bp2->bio_length > pp->mediasize)
                        bp2->bio_length = pp->mediasize - bp2->bio_offset;
                bp2->bio_done = g_std_done;
                bp2->bio_offset += entry->gpe_offset;
                g_io_request(bp2, cp);
                return;
        case BIO_SPEEDUP:
        case BIO_FLUSH:
                break;
        case BIO_GETATTR:
                if (g_handleattr_int(bp, "GEOM::fwheads", table->gpt_heads))
                        return;
                if (g_handleattr_int(bp, "GEOM::fwsectors", table->gpt_sectors))
                        return;
                /*
                 * allow_nesting overrides "isleaf" to false _unless_ the
                 * provider offset is zero, since otherwise we would recurse.
                 */
                if (g_handleattr_int(bp, "PART::isleaf",
                        table->gpt_isleaf &&
                        (allow_nesting == 0 || entry->gpe_offset == 0)))
                        return;
                if (g_handleattr_int(bp, "PART::depth", table->gpt_depth))
                        return;
                if (g_handleattr_str(bp, "PART::scheme",
                    table->gpt_scheme->name))
                        return;
                if (g_handleattr_str(bp, "PART::type",
                    G_PART_TYPE(table, entry, buf, sizeof(buf))))
                        return;
                if (!strcmp("GEOM::physpath", bp->bio_attribute)) {
                        done_func = g_part_get_physpath_done;
                        break;
                }
                if (!strcmp("GEOM::kerneldump", bp->bio_attribute)) {
                        /*
                         * Check that the partition is suitable for kernel
                         * dumps. Typically only swap partitions should be
                         * used. If the request comes from the nested scheme
                         * we allow dumping there as well.
                         */
                        if ((bp->bio_from == NULL ||
                            bp->bio_from->geom->class != &g_part_class) &&
                            G_PART_DUMPTO(table, entry) == 0) {
                                g_io_deliver(bp, ENODEV);
                                printf("GEOM_PART: Partition '%s' not suitable"
                                    " for kernel dumps (wrong type?)\n",
                                    pp->name);
                                return;
                        }
                        gkd = (struct g_kerneldump *)bp->bio_data;
                        if (gkd->offset >= pp->mediasize) {
                                g_io_deliver(bp, EIO);
                                return;
                        }
                        if (gkd->offset + gkd->length > pp->mediasize)
                                gkd->length = pp->mediasize - gkd->offset;
                        gkd->offset += entry->gpe_offset;
                }
                break;
        default:
                g_io_deliver(bp, EOPNOTSUPP);
                return;
        }

        bp2 = g_clone_bio(bp);
        if (bp2 == NULL) {
                g_io_deliver(bp, ENOMEM);
                return;
        }
        bp2->bio_done = done_func;
        g_io_request(bp2, cp);
}
